Twice a year, in March and September, Workday — SLU’s integrated, cloud-based administrative and finance system — releases feature upgrades designed to increase functionality and enhance the user experience.
Below learn about what changes users can expect, what steps (if any), users might need to take to prepare for the new upgrades, and what dates Workday will be unavailable during this routine maintenance.

New Features and Enhancements
While most updates coming this weekend will center around back-end improvements (which end-users will not notice), a few exciting changes are in the works with this round of updates.
- Improved Look for Team Org Chart – When reviewing Org charts in Workday (found after selecting the Team icon from a Worker’s Profile page), users will notice larger employee/position cards and enhanced color contrast for easier reading and navigation.
- Real-Time Validation for Required Form Fields – Allows errors to display during data entry instead of waiting for the user to hit submit and receive the error.
- New Manager Experience on Homepage – If the user is someone that manages people they will see a new section on your homepage entitled ‘Important Dates’. This will give you a quick glance at your team’s upcoming time off, birthdays, anniversaries, and University Holidays.
